摘要: 综述了纳米粒子在聚合物/纳米粒子复合材料超临界流体发泡中的应用及其对聚合物发泡行为的影响机理,分析了聚合物/纳米粒子复合材料发泡的影响因素,并展望了聚合物/纳米粒子复合材料发泡材料的应用前景。

Abstract: This paper reviewed applications of nanoparticles in supercritical fluid foaming process for polymer nanocomposites as well as their effects on forming mechanisms of the nanocomposites. Effect of nanoparticles on bubble nucleation and growth of polymer foaming were discussed, and factors for the foaming process of polymer-based nanocomposites were analyzed. The trend in development of polymer nanocomposite foams was prospected.
